About this item
Showcase your love for antique décor with this exquisite oval copper tray signed by Herbert Dyer-Cornwall. The tray, has hand engraved fish along the bottom by the scalloped edges and was made during the Arts & Crafts movement and originates from Cornwall, United Kingdom, making it a rare and valuable find for collectors.Crafted in the early 1900s and preserving its originality, this tray is a delightful addition to any collection. The Newlyn Style maker has used only the finest copper materials to hand hammer and etch this trays unique design. Embrace history and bring this beautiful piece of antiquity to your home today.
This tray is not only functional but is an exceptional work of art that can be displayed. It measures an impressive 52 cm long, 31 cm wide and 3 cm deep. Exquisite Detail (see photo's for the details and signature)
